Hi Amelia!

What a sweet shop you have! Cute bears and lovely soap!

As someone mentioned above about convertion from inches to cm, if you find it easier then why not put one photo of where you hold the bear in your hand, so from that view people can compare how big the bear actually is. The measurments do very little to myself actually.

As for the soap - myself being vegan and not seeing any ingredients on your description is a big turn off. It makes me thing you (might) use some dodgy materials, and as someone else mentioned, people buying handmade soaps mostly look out for those that are organic and contain natural ingredients. Seeing that you have nothing mentioned about it, I would click away from your shop in an instant. Check out the other soap sellers, some of them are very open and honest, even if that means showing all the ingredients and even those that are a little bit artificial (colourants etc).

I personally avoid bright coloured soaps as I know they contain colorants and if I buy HANDMADE soap, I expect it to be much better quality than the one available on high street. Your soaps are lovely, the photos are good but try adding more specific info on what's IN the soaps.

Also, if you have a good ingredient, you can mention what benefit it gives to the skin... It makes me think that this seller really knows what he/she is doing! Hope this helps and good luck!
